HOW TO WIND YOUR AUTOMATIC WATCH

Our self winding timepieces are designed to gain power from the natural movements of the wrist on the person who is wearing the watch. Manually winding it every day is unnecessary and you also do not need a battery.

Wind an automatic watch by turning the crown enough to jump start the power source, and then allowing the self winding mechanism to work by simply wearing the timepiece! Winding is also required when the watch gets low on power due to not being used for a period of time.

For a self-winding watch to function properly, the mainspring must build up a sufficient power reserve. Many people are unaware that a self-winding watch needs to be wound first manually before it will run automatically.  This is called the initiation process.  Without the initiation process, the watch will never operate properly or consistently.

To initiate the power reserve, the watch must be wound manually.  Turn the winding crown at the 3 o’clock position, in a clockwise direction for about 30 revolutions.  This start up wind is usually sufficient for most automatic watches.

(Please do not continue to wind your timepiece you feel that the spring is already fully loaded otherwise the clockwork may be damaged)

After completion of the initiation process, the watch will wind itself automatically (rebuilding the power reserve) by means of an oscillation weight that shifts every time the watch’s position is changed by the action of the arm and wrist. Put on your watch and swing your wrist back and forth for approximately 30 seconds to initialize power reserve.

A self-winding watch should be worn at least eight hours a day to maximize the power reserve.  If this is not possible, or if the watch has been off the wrist for more than 15-20 hours, the initiation process must be repeated.

ARE ZINVO TIMEPIECES WATER RESISTANT?

All of our pieces are 5ATM Water Resistance. This level of protection will easily withstand splashes or brief immersion in water, or getting caught in the rain, as well as swimming or bathing (please remain the crown closed at all times).
